[Virus-specific syntheses in cells infected with the virions from standard and "defective" populations of the influenza virus (author's transl)].

Abstract

The structure of influenza virus virions from the standard and "Magnus" populations as well as intracellular syntheses induced by them were studied. Virions of influenza virus were shown to be heterogeneous with respect to the set of fragments in them. This heterogeneity was more marked in virions of the "Magnus" population and consisted in a relatively greater deficiency of large fragments. A marked induction of light RNA fractions in the cell by defective influenza virus was demonstrated. Synthesis of protein and the polypeptide composition of virions were found to be similiar in standard and "Magnus" viruses.
